Description

The ADIS16260/ADIS16265 are complete angular rate measurement systems available in a single compact package enabled by Analog Devices, Inc.

iSensor™ integration.

Preliminary Technical Data FEATURES Yaw rate gyroscope with range scaling ±80°/sec, ±160°/sec, and ±320°/sec settings SPI®-compatible serial interface Calibrated sensitivity and bias ADIS16260: +25°C ADIS16265: −40°C to +85°C Operating temperature range: −40°C to +105°C Digital temperature sensor output In-system, auto-zero for bias drift calibration Digitally controlled sample rate, up to 2048SPS Digitally controlled frequency response 50/300Hz Sensor bandwidth selection Programmable Bartlett Window FIR filter Dual alarm settings with configurable operation Embedded integration for short-term angle estimates Digitally activated self-test Digitally activated low power mode Interrupt-driven wake-up Auxiliary 12-bit ADC input and 12-bit DAC output Auxiliary digital input/output Single-supply
